React kullanarak güçlü bir arayüz nasıl yapılır
Başından beri bir web sitesi veya uygulama geliştirmek anıtsal bir görevdir. Kodlama, test ve başlatma, özellikle kullanıcılar sezgisel ve iyi tasarlanmış bir arayüz beklediğinde kolay bir işlem değildir. Dolayısıyla, seçtiğiniz dil için iyi geliştirilen kütüphaneyi uygulamak – JavaScript için React gibi – mantıklıdır. React gibi JavaScript çerçevesi, ön uç kullanıcı etkileşimlerini geliştirmenize yardımcı olacak önceden yazılmış kodlar sağlar. Bu, sitenizin veya uygulamanızın benzersiz kısımlarına odaklanmanız için size daha fazla zaman verir. Böylece, güçlü bir arayüz ve tema oluşturmak düşündüğünüzden çok daha basit hale gelir.
Bu makalede, olağanüstü WordPress arayüzleri yapmak için Neyin React’i en iyi çözümü ve kendiniz başarmak için adımlar atmasını keşfedeceğiz. Bölünelim! React’e Giriş Daha önce hiç React kullanmadıysanız, hoş geldiniz! Bu, Facebook tarafından geliştirilen ve geliştiricilerin kullanıcı arayüzünü yapmasına yardımcı olan bir JavaScript kütüphanesidir. Örneğin, Snap Shot aynı şekilde arama işlevine sahip bir galeri uygulamasıdır:
Örneğin, dünyadaki büyük ve büyük şirketlere yol açan bazıları React kullanıyor. Bu, neredeyse tüm Facebook, Reddit, Uber, CNN, Netflix ve daha birçok şirketi içerir. Geliştiriciler için, odaklanmış bir kullanıcı deneyimi (UX) oluşturmak için React’i kullanmak için bir takım avantajlar vardır. Örneğin: Bu, öğrenmesi kolay ve diğer karşılaştırılabilir kütüphanelerden daha fazla üretken ve kullanımı tartışmasız bir dildir.
‘Bileşen’ – temel olarak modüler reaksiyon yapı taşı – arayüzün belirli bölümlerini temsil eder ve yeniden kullanılabilir.
Hata ayıklama kütüphane ve diğer çerçevelerden daha hızlıdır.
React’i kullanmaya başlamak için daha fazla neden var. Ancak, özellikle WordPress için kullanırken, kendinize yardımcı olacak başka araçlar görmek isteyebilirsiniz.
WordPress ekosisteminde tepki vermenin geliştirilmesine başlamak, WordPress topluluğunun “JavaScript’i derinlemesine öğrenmeye” teşvik edilmesinden bu yana beş yıl geçti. Süreçteki ilk adımlardan biri genellikle bir çerçeve seçmektir. React’in bir JavaScript olduğu göz önüne alındığında, WordPress ile çalışan ve kendi güçlü yönlerini artırırken tepki veren bir kitaplık seçmelisiniz. Frontity, son zamanlarda kaliteli bir JavaScript çerçevesi olarak çok fazla gürültü yaptı ve Automattic’in desteğiyle de donatılmış. WP React başlangıç, özellikle eklentilerin geliştirilmesi için de sağlam bir seçimdir.
Bu bölümde örnekler görüntülenirken, çeşitli nedenlerle React WP temasını oluşturacağız:
Bu, WP React başlangıç için bir ‘ortak’ olarak kabul edilebilir.
Resmi React uygulamasının uygulama komutu cihazına dayandığını görünce, React WP teması oluşturun güçlü bir soybilimseldir. Bu aracı etkinleştirmek ve çalıştırmak çok kolaydır.
Bu son nokta en çok sevdiğimiz şeydir. Aslında, size sadece üç adımda nasıl başlayacağınızı gösterebiliriz. React kullanarak güçlü bir arayüz nasıl yapılır (3 adımda) Aşağıdaki üç adım, Create-React-WPTHEME’yi başlatmak ve çalıştırmak için gereken temel adımlarda size yönlendirin. Bu çerçeveyi kullanarak neler başarabileceğiniz konusunda daha derine dalmak için GitHub sayfasını kontrol etmenizi öneririz.
Adım 1: Temanızı Oluşturun İlk adımınız, komut satırını kullanarak temanızın temel kodu olan bir çekirdek oluşturmaktır. Terminal veya PowerShell arayüzünü bir WordPress geliştiricisi olarak kullanmaya alışkın olduğunuzu varsayalım. Her şeyden önce WordPress sunucunuzu başlatmak ve genellikle WP-Content dizinindeki kurulum tema klasörünüzde değiştirmek istediğiniz. Çeşitli vagrant vagrants kullanıyorsanız, sitenizin public_html dizininde olması muhtemeldir. Buradan bir sonraki adım, aşağıdakilerle React WP temasını oluşturun:
NPX Create-React-wptheme Themename Tema adını söylemek istediğiniz her şeyle yer tutucusunu değiştirmek istersiniz. Ayrıca, TypeScript kullanıcıları komuta -typescript eklemelidir.
Ardından, şu komutla yeni oluşturulan klasörü girin: Themename/React-SRC CD’si aşağıdakileri kullanarak çalıştırın: NPM Run Start Hata mesajını burada göreceksiniz ve ‘Observer’ çıkacak. Bunun nedeni, uygulanması gereken bazı ek PHP gereksinimleri olmasıdır. Bunu yapmak için WordPress kontrol panelinizi açın ve görünüm> temaları tıklayın. Ardından, yeni temanıza geçin ve sitenizi ön tarafta görün. Son olarak, NPM RUN’u komut satırından tekrar çalıştırın ve tarayıcınızın yenilenmesini ve sıçrama-reaksiyon-uygulama sıçrama sayfasını varsayılan olarak görüntülediğini göreceksiniz:
Bu WordPress temanız. Şimdi geliştirme zamanı! Adım 2: Temanızı geliştirin Bu eğlenceli bir parça – reaksiyon tabanlı bir WordPress teması için vizyonunuzu alın ve gerçeğe dönüştürün. Tabii ki, buradaki kapsam çok büyük ve düşünmek istediğiniz her şeyi kapsayamayız. Ancak, başlamak için doğru yer klasik, “Merhaba, dünya!” örnek. Başlamadan önce, JavaScript hakkında güçlü bir anlayışa ihtiyacınız olacak, çünkü öğrenme aynı zamanda reaksiyon ve javascript de büyük bir iş.
Becerileriniz keskin olduktan sonra React Code: Reactdom.render (